As a Digital Hardware Development Engineer in our Public Safety group, you will be responsible for maintaining and developing control hardware solutions for use in public safety radio products.

Responsibilities:

  • Support and maintain current shipping radio and console products.

  • New development and support of digital, analog, and audio designs used in our Mission Critical Public Safety communication systems.

  • Digital circuitry development, including Microprocessor/DSP, FPGA, memory, and Ethernet interface.

  • Analog circuitry development, including audio circuitry, codec interfacing, audio gain, and power amplifier design.

  • Circuit simulation of Electrical designs and utilizing the latest test equipment for circuit analysis and certification.

  • Automated test setup and execution using Python scripting.
